www.DataSheet4U.com NUS1204MN Overvoltage Protection IC with Integrated MOSFET This device represents a new level of safety and integration by combining the NCP304 overvoltage protection circuit (OVP) with a −12 V P−Channel power MOSFET. It is specifically designed to protect sensitive electronic circuitry from overvoltage transients and power supply faults. During such hazardous events, the IC quickly disconnects the input supply from the load, thus protecting the load before any damage can occur. The OVP IC is optimized for applications using an external AC−DC adapter or a car accessory charger to power a portable product or recharge its internal batteries. It has a nominal overvoltage threshold of 4.725 V which makes it ideal for single cell Li−Ion as well as 3/4 cell NiCD/NiMH applications.
